Construction skills shortage will hinder recovery when the economy improves
(27/05/2009)

According to the Chartered Institute of Building's (CIOB) third annual skills survey, the industry is still suffering a skills shortage despite the recession and downturn in construction demand. 77% of respondents believe there is a skills shortage in construction and 78% of those feel that the loss of skills will hinder the industry's recovery when the economy improves.
